  • Mohammad Biglarian, Hamidreza Bakhshi, Parastoo Jafarnezhad Sani Page 1
    Cluster is one of the lifetime increase of wsn. The number and the size of cluster and cluster head selection is the main factor. Increase of cluster size causes the increase of distance and the early discharge. Decrease of cluster size causes the increase of sending of overhead controlling information. Inappropriate selection of the cluster increases the distance to the member of cluster and other cluster heads. In this article, we follow the increase of lifetime in angle clustering using Three cluster heads in wsn. Cluster head selection in this methods is related to remained energy, the average distance to the members and distance between current cluster head and previous one. This way, the new cluster head and the previous one does change, if the continuous working time becomes lower than optimum value. The continuous working time of cluster head is related to the optimum one hop distance and angle clustering. Simulation result reveals that above methods have caused the lifetime increasing of the wsn..

  • Fatemeh Rezaie, Mohsen Shahmohammadi, Mohammad Alimoradi, Ali Reza Agha Yousefi Page 15
    Handwriting is used by analyzers to detect personality of an individual, but this task is time consuming and expensive. Therefore computer aided techniques can be used. The science of study and analysis of human personality based on his handwriting is named graphology. In addition, any handwriting has many features. This paper in order to graphology analyses is focused on the points detection in Farsi handwriting.According to the basic features of handwriting image such as pen width, size of words and base line, we propose three methods to detect points: detecting based on the area values, detecting based on the location of points or combination of these two properties. Proposed methods tested on various Farsi handwriting images. Results show third method which is based on the area of points and the location of points is more accurate than other methods.
  • Ahmad Habibizad Navi, Nafiseh Bahrami Noor Page 19

    Grid technology provides sharing different types of resources. Since resources are heterogeneous and geographically distributed in grid environments, therefore using these resources requires suitable resource discovery techniques. One of these methods is using RDV tables, where resources are clustered based on specific interests and these clusters create a graph. In this method, some additional and deceptive information is stored in the RDV tables. According to the dynamism of grid environment, importing this information in tables is unnecessary and causes cycles in resource discovery mechanism; therefore some requests will be directed wrongly to offline resources.. In this paper cycles are eliminated by applying some changes in recording information in the tables. Obtained results show that the presented method has better performance than previous one with respect to the number of hops and routing time.

  • Behrooz Ameri Shahrabi, Samane Hosseinmardi, Mohammad Ebrahim Shiri Ahmad Abadi Page 23
    Various methods have been proposed to solve the traveling salesman problem such as a solution based on genetic algorithm. But in general, these algorithms and especially genetic algorithm are often faced with early convergence in solving combinatorial problem, in this paper we review and introduce new methods and survey to solve the problem. Our idea based on hybrid genetic algorithm for solving the traveling salesman problem. The implementation of our algorithm is that different methods at each step of the algorithm, including initial population by the nearest neighbor, greedy algorithm and combination of them with the genetic algorithm and also different methods for mutation operator has been surveyed. Combining untwist algorithm with genetic algorithm to improve the population and is expected to strengthen the global optimal solution. When the diversity of the population is reduced, artificial chromosomes with high diversity level are introduce to increase the diversity level in the system. Implementation has been shown the improvement result of hybrid algorithm than the pure genetic algorithm.
  • Mohsen Shahmohammadi, Toktam Alizadeh Looshabi, Mohammad Mansour Riyahi Kashani Page 30
    Along with the development of content and text filtering systems, identifying and highlighting Quranic verses inside texts has been considered by researchers for years. Therefore we have designed and implemented an intelligent system that can detect and highlight Quranic verses in various texts automatically. This system is an information retrieval system and it uses text mining and pattern matching algorithms. Because of Quranic spelling variations and differences, there are many challenges in this system, so that makes it beyond the usual pattern matching systems. The main algorithm of this system is a new index-based multiple pattern matching algorithm that its main idea is mapping the text and patterns to numeric arrays and process on the numbers instead of text. Experimental results show that processing on numerical values rather than text has a significant impact on increasing the performance of algorithm to be faster and more precise.
  • Tahmineh Mirzaei Solhi Page 34
    With increasing growth in the users’ demand for high throughput, more and more energy is consumed in Wireless Mesh Networks (WMNs). On the other hand, energy efficiency is an important issue in contexts of using the energy-constrained resources or having an eco-friendly network. Since network throughput is correlated to the rate at which users send their data, we can reach to energy efficiency target in WMNs by controlling the users’ rate. Motivated by this, here we present an approach to control the users’ rate. The proposed approach is formulated by using the linear optimization framework that its objective is maximization of throughput subject to the required constraints on network lifetime and devices’ function time. Also, we formulate the problem of users’ rate control as Multi-Objective Linear Programming (MOLP) to find a tradeoff between maximizing the throughput and minimizing the aggregated power consumption of relay Wireless Mesh Routers (WMRs). Our numerical results show the effect of devices’ initial energy and function time on the network throughput. Also, our experiments illustrate a tradeoff relationship between the network throughput and lifetime, and also, the linear relationship between network throughput and aggregated power consumption of relay WMRs.
  • Ahmad Parijaee Moghaddam, Sajjad Mousavi Page 39
    There are two model for learning in machine learning: symbolic learning and sub-symbolic learning. decision tree is a symbolic approach that is very comprehensible and interpretable. neural network is sub-symbolic approach that is very stable and flexible. neural network tree is a hybrid learning model with the overall structure being a decision tree and each non-terminal node containing a neural network that try to combine advantage of decision tree and neural network. Experiment result shows that, in general, neural network tree is better than traditional decision tree, because neural network is better than one feature..
